The Role of the Meatpacking District
The location of Prolog Coffee Bar in the Meatpacking District adds significantly to its identity. The area, known as the, has evolved into one of New York City’s most dynamic neighborhoods. Once dominated by warehouses and meat processing facilities, it has been transformed into a center for fashion, art, and modern lifestyle experiences.
Today, the district attracts a mix of professionals, tourists, and creatives. Its cobblestone streets, historic buildings, and modern developments create a unique environment where old and new coexist. Prolog Coffee Bar fits naturally into this setting by offering a contemporary café experience that complements the district’s cultural energy.

Influence of Modern Coffee Trends
Prolog Coffee Bar reflects several global trends in modern coffee culture. One of the most significant is the rise of third-wave coffee, which treats coffee as an artisanal product similar to wine or craft food. This movement emphasizes transparency, sustainability, and quality at every stage of production.
Another trend is the integration of café spaces into lifestyle experiences. Rather than being purely functional, cafés are now designed to be visually appealing and emotionally engaging. Prolog Coffee Bar embodies this approach through its design, menu, and overall atmosphere.
